《大型網站技術架構》讀書筆記 - 架構的模式 大CC上周寫的讀書筆記記錄的是網絡的升級路線,其中用到的各種技術手段只是點到即止(《大型網站技術架構》讀書筆記 - 網站的技術升級路線);今天寫的第二篇筆記,討論架構的模式;這篇文章,其中主干是書中的重點筆記,分支和內容則是我展開的思考; 需要 ...
此篇已收錄至 大型網站技術架構 讀書筆記系列目錄貼,點擊訪問該目錄可獲取更多內容。 一 大型網站系統特點 高並發 大流量:PV量巨大 高可用: 小時不間斷服務 海量數據:文件數目分分鍾xxTB 用戶分布廣泛,網絡情況復雜:網絡運營商 安全環境惡劣:黑客的攻擊 需求快速變更,發布頻繁:快速適應市場,滿足用戶需求 漸進式發展:慢慢地運營出大型網站 二 大型網站架構演化過程 初始階段網站架構:一台Ser ...
2014-06-07 01:40 23 10550 推薦指數:
《大型網站技術架構》讀書筆記 - 架構的模式 大CC上周寫的讀書筆記記錄的是網絡的升級路線,其中用到的各種技術手段只是點到即止(《大型網站技術架構》讀書筆記 - 網站的技術升級路線);今天寫的第二篇筆記,討論架構的模式;這篇文章,其中主干是書中的重點筆記,分支和內容則是我展開的思考; 需要 ...
架構設計中要考慮的核心五要素; 性能、可用性、擴展性、伸縮性、安全性 性能 性能的測試指標 響應時間 應用執行一個操作需要的時間,包括從發出請求開始到收到最后響應數據所需要的時間。響應時間是系統最重要的性能指標,直觀地反映了系統的“快慢”。下表列出了一些常用的系統操作需要的響應時間 ...
此篇已收錄至《大型網站技術架構》讀書筆記系列目錄貼,點擊訪問該目錄可獲取更多內容。 一、性能—響應時間決定用戶 (1)瀏覽器端: ①瀏覽器緩存; ②使用頁面壓縮; PS:Gzip壓縮效率非常高,通常可以達到70%的壓縮率,也就是說,如果你的網頁有30K,壓縮之后 ...
此篇已收錄至《大型網站技術架構》讀書筆記系列目錄貼,點擊訪問該目錄可獲取更多內容。 一、分層 最常見的架構模式,將系統在橫向維度上切分成幾個部分,每個部分單一職責。網站一般分為三個層次:應用層、服務層和數據層,其具體結構如下圖所示: 通過分層,一個龐大系統切分成不同部分,便於 ...
花了幾個晚上看完了《大型網站技術架構》這本書,個人感覺這本書的廣度還行,深度還有些欠缺(畢竟只有200頁左右)。但是作為一個缺乏大型網站技術的IT民工,看完一遍還是很有收獲的,至少對一個網站的技術演進、需要解決的問題有了一個全面的認識。文中也有一些作者個人的心得、感悟、總結,我覺得 ...
用戶需求 (7)漸進式發展:慢慢地運營出大型網站 二、大型網站架構演化過程 (1)初始階段 ...
作者:13 GitHub:https://github.com/ZHENFENG13 版權聲明:本文為原創文章,未經允許不得轉載。 此篇已收錄至《大型網站技術架構:核心原理與案例分析》讀書筆記系列,點擊訪問該目錄獲取完整內容。 何謂大型網站 大型網站系統特點: ps:符合 ...
此篇已收錄至《大型網站技術架構》讀書筆記系列目錄貼,點擊訪問該目錄可獲取更多內容。 一、可伸縮與可擴展—傻傻分不清楚 上篇筆記我們學習了可伸縮架構,但在實際場合中,包括許多架構師也常常混淆可伸縮和可擴展,用可擴展表示伸縮性。那么在此,跟隨作者我們來理清這兩個概念,避免我們以后對其傻傻 ...